Item type:Publication, APPLICATION OF PULSED EDDY CURRENT TECHNIQUE FOR INSPECTION OF INSULATED PIPES(Faculty of mechanical engineering- Skopje, 2024) ;Krstevska, Aleksandra ;Serafimovski, Filip; ; In this paper the use of Pulsed Eddy Current (PEC) technique is analyzed for inspecting insulated pipes, commonly used in industries such as power generation, petrochemical, and oil and gas. PEC technique uses pulsed electromagnetic fields to generate eddy currents in the conductive material, allowing detection in wall thickness and material integrity. In the experimental part an insulated pipe is investigated with the PEC technique for corrosion or wall thinning defect of the material, without the need to remove the insulation. The paper involves experimental testing on insulated pipe of structural steel with composite insulation and the results show the potential of PEC as a reliable tool for maintenance and inspection, especially for reducing operational costs and downtime associated with insulation removal. - Some of the metrics are blocked by yourconsent settings
Item type:Publication, Mechanical Properties of steel P91 and steel 12X1812T in dissimilar pipe welds used in boiler components(University of Slavonski Brod, 2023) ;Krstevska, Aleksandra; ; Petreski, MartinThe various welded joints used in production, most often in piping systems, always represent a special critical place in the system itself, seen in terms of possible occurrences of damage (defects). In the case of welding various joints of low-alloy and high-alloy steels, problems often arise due to the choice of additional materials, because the additional material according to the carbon content may more suit only one of the steels in the joint, usually the lower grade. The selected additive material, on the other hand, determines the properties of the welded joint, because it dictates the development of specific metallurgical processes in welding in which certain phases take place, which in turn are characterized by certain properties. The experimental investigation was made of dissimilar metal weld (DMW) joints between martensitic steel type P91 and austenitic steel type 12X18H12T using ERNiCr-3 filler metal. The as received P91 steel has been buttered using ERNiCr-3 filler metal, subjected to post weld heat treatment (PWHT) at 760°C for 120 min followed by air cooling and then welded with steel 12X18H12T by tungsten inert gas welding process without any PWHT after welding. Mechanical properties (tensile strength and hardness) and microstructure were investigated on the welded joints. - Some of the metrics are blocked by yourconsent settings
